Birds, Birding, Banding

March 18 | 11 AM - 12 PM

Meet Megan Murante! Megan works with the Zoo’s Programming and Education department. Megan is also a dedicated volunteer for Braddock Bay Bird Observatory and proud “Bird Nerd”! As a volunteer bird bander, Megan will share what it takes to band songbirds, which involves catching them in mist nets, collecting data from each individual, and putting a special band with an identifying serial number on them.  Learn the ins and outs of bird identification, field work, and the fascinating array of birds right here in our neighborhood.
